
Nalu Vida Venice is the newest addition to the Washington Blvd strip. Situated right on the beach, this tropical hideaway is the perfect spot to grab a drink and some food after a day at the beach. Featuring a diverse menu with tropical, Caribbean and Latin influences, there is something for every palate.
Easygoing seafood restaurant with a raw bar, offering brunch & sandwiches, plus creative cocktails.

The drink I ordered was the old fashion with 14 year old scotch, there was a rep from Glendfiddch there and she was giving out free drinks.
The food was good, the chips and guac was fine, their red salsa was good. The crispy rice was also very flavorful, the hosin sauce drizzle on the plate brought it all together. I looked at the specials and couldn’t resist getting the in-n-out burger flat bread. Ok first of all, it does taste like in-n-out, I was shocked and surprised! For $17, I thought it was reasonable and tasty. I would like to come back for brunch when it’s a little warmer but the heaters were perfect.
The service was also good, the food came out fast once we were able to order. I think there was only 2 servers when we were there so it just took a little bit to track them down. Overall, it was a decent evening.
I was looking for a vegan-friendly spot close to the beach in Marina del Rey for my friend and me — and we found this gem. The energy was relaxed, the location couldn’t be better, and the menu? Full of pleasant surprises.
I ordered the vegan tacos, and they were everything. Fresh, flavorful, well-balanced — the kind of meal that makes you feel light but full in the best way. You can tell they care about quality here, not just checking a plant-based box.
The service was friendly, and the space felt calm and intentional. This was one of those unexpected finds that I’ll absolutely be coming back to. If you’re near Venice or Marina and want something vegan without sacrificing vibes — this is it.
